Eagle Cam - live webcam view of 2 Bald Eagles and their young eaglet

I stumbled on this the other day, it's a live webcam view of a Bald Eagle nest on the Berry College campus in Rome, Georgia. Their chick hatched on Feb 22, making it about 2 1/2 weeks old right now.
